When did humans started wearing clothes
Ralf Kittler, Manfred Kayser and Mark Stoneking, anthropologists at the Max Planck Institute for Evolutionary Anthropology, conducted a genetic analysis of human body lice that suggests clothing originated around 170,000 years ago.

Are humans the only animals that wear clothes
Humans may be called “naked apes,” but most of us wear clothing, a fact that makes us unique in the animal kingdom, save for the clothing we make for other animals. The development of clothing has even influenced the evolution of other species — the body louse, unlike all other kinds, clings to clothing, not hair.

Did early humans wear clothes
UF study of lice DNA shows humans first wore clothes 170,000 years ago. … The data shows modern humans started wearing clothes about 70,000 years before migrating into colder climates and higher latitudes, which began about 100,000 years ago.

Do we need clothes to survive
There are good reasons to do so: in colder climes we would freeze to death without some extra padding, and in intense heat clothing can also shield us from the Sun. However, some hunter-gatherer societies still choose to live mostly naked, which suggests that clothing is not vital for our survival.
